Jeremy,
Thanks for the reply. That's another option I hadn't
thought of. Having separate models for the driver and
terminator would avoid redundant driver models, and
the user doesn't have to text edit the file. However,
it does require them to change their component setup
in the simulator to switch from the output model to
the input model.
I guess I'll have to pick my poison and figure out
which solution is the least painful.
Thanks,
Michael
--- Jeremy Plunkett <jeremy@broadcom.com> wrote:
> Michael,
> As long as your driver and terminator are separate
> components on die and
> don't have any unusual interactions, it should be no
> problem to just build
> them as separate IBIS models. There is no issue
> with connecting multiple
> IBIS models to the same die pad.
>
> Jeremy
>
> -----Original Message-----
> From: owner-ibis-users@eda.org
> [mailto:owner-ibis-users@eda.org] On Behalf
> Of Michael Sachtjen
> Sent: Thursday, February 10, 2005 11:10 AM
> To: ibis-users@eda.org
> Cc: michael.l.sachtjen@tek.com
> Subject: [IBIS-Users] Programable drive and
> termination strenght
>
>
> Greetings,
>
> I have a GDDR3 interface with programmable drive
> strength, as well as programmable, dynamic on-die
> termination strength. I'm handling the programmable
> drive strength using the Model Selector and I'm
> handling the on-die termination using a
> Dynamic_clamp
> Submodel. However, since I have programmable
> termination values as well, and the Model Selector
> seems to only work for the top model, not submodels,
> I
> need to duplicate each of my top models for every
> combination of submodel. Either that, or have
> multiple enteries in the Add Submodel section and
> comment out all but the one model I want to use.
> Then
> I have to text edit the file every time I want to
> use
> a different termination strength.
>
> Is there something that I'm missing? Is there a way
> of selecting a drive strength, and termination
> strength, independent of each other without
> replicating the top model for every possible sub
> module? Right now I'm modeling 4 drive strengths
> and
> 2 termination values, but worst case scenario is 15
> settings of each.
>
> Here are some snippets of my ibis file to clarify
> what
> I'm doing:
>
> [Model Selector] GDDR3_PAD
> |
> GDDR3_OCD6_ODT4 drive strength = 6X, termination =
> 4X
> GDDR3_OCD6_ODT2 drive strength = 6X, termination =
> 2X
> | etc.
>
> [Model] GDDR3_OCD6_ODT4
> [Add Submodel]
> ODT4 Non-Driving
> |
> | Complete model for drive strength = 6X
>
> [Model] GDDR3_OCD6_ODT2
> [Add Submodel]
> ODT2 Non-Driving
> |
> | Complete model for drive strength = 6X
>
> [Submodel] ODT4
> Submodel_type Dynamic_clamp
> [POWER Clamp]
> | .
>
> [Submodel] ODT2
> Submodel_type Dynamic_clamp
> [POWER Clamp]
> | .
>
> Thank you,
>
> Michael
>
>
>
> __________________________________
> Do you Yahoo!?
> Yahoo! Mail - 250MB free storage. Do more. Manage
> less.
> http://info.mail.yahoo.com/mail_250
>
|------------------------------------------------------------------
> |For help or to subscribe/unsubscribe, email
> majordomo@eda.org with just
> |the appropriate command message(s) in the body:
> |
> | help
> | subscribe ibis <optional e-mail address,
> if different>
> | subscribe ibis-users <optional e-mail address,
> if different>
> | unsubscribe ibis <optional e-mail address,
> if different>
> | unsubscribe ibis-users <optional e-mail address,
> if different>
> |
> |or email a written request to ibis-request@eda.org.
> |
> |IBIS reflector archives exist under:
> |
> | http://www.eda.org/pub/ibis/email_archive/
> Recent
> | http://www.eda.org/pub/ibis/users_archive/ Recent
> | http://www.eda.org/pub/ibis/email/
> E-mail since 1993
>
>
>
>
>
>
>
__________________________________
Do you Yahoo!?
Yahoo! Mail - 250MB free storage. Do more. Manage less.
http://info.mail.yahoo.com/mail_250
|------------------------------------------------------------------
|For help or to subscribe/unsubscribe, email majordomo@eda.org
|with just the appropriate command message(s) in the body:
|
| help
| subscribe ibis <optional e-mail address, if different>
| subscribe ibis-users <optional e-mail address, if different>
| unsubscribe ibis <optional e-mail address, if different>
| unsubscribe ibis-users <optional e-mail address, if different>
|
|or email a written request to ibis-request@eda.org.
|
|IBIS reflector archives exist under:
|
| http://www.eda.org/pub/ibis/email_archive/ Recent
| http://www.eda.org/pub/ibis/users_archive/ Recent
| http://www.eda.org/pub/ibis/email/ E-mail since 1993
Received on Mon Feb 14 14:00:46 2005
This archive was generated by hypermail 2.1.8 : Mon Feb 14 2005 - 14:05:30 PST